Transaction ef406c426d8c6f6135207685ffdffbbe93aaf120d4d8fe283b6015e6f195b881
1 Input
1 Output
-
ef406c426d8c6f6135207685ffdffbbe93aaf120d4d8fe283b6015e6f195b881:0
- value
- 65156467
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d335d707a82a1fb1e05fa0d00c054f4c33f3ed80 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LFn5LrNNx74yV9LAvMDhzRciBtXfX8ToM